أَخْبَرَنَا عُبَيْدُ اللَّهِ بْنُ عَبْدِ الْمَجِيدِ  ، حَدَّثَنِي عُبَيْدُ اللَّهِ بْنُ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نِ مَوْهَبٍ  ، أَخْبَرَنَا نَافِعُ بْنُ جُبَيْرِ بْنِ مُطْعِمٍ  ، عَنِ اب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   : أَنّ رَسُولَ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، قَالَ :" الْأَيِّمُ أَمْلَكُ بِأَمْرِهَا مِنْ وَلِيِّهَا، وَالْبِكْرُ تُسْتَأْمَرُ فِي نَفْسِهَا، وَصَمْتُهَا إِقْرَارُهَا "
